Termite Treatments Canberra require to be personalized to resolve the substantial threats particular kinds of termites, such as Coptotermes frenchi and Nasutitermes exitiosus. Coptotermes frenchi is understood for being secretive and tends to construct nests the root crowns of living trees like eucalypts, making it tough to detect due to its broad foraging range. On the other hand, Nasutitermes exitiosus constructs dark mound nests and is a common pest that relies on wetness and underground tunnels to gain access to structures for consuming timber parts. Starting an effective management strategy starts with an extensive annual termite evaluation, which need to be carried out by an accredited expert who complies with existing building regulations. Today's assessments extend beyond simple visual assessments, leveraging advanced tools such as thermal imaging video cameras that can sense heat emissions from termite colonies concealed behind walls, and wetness meters that recognize locations of increased humidity that draw these insects. By making use of these innovative technologies, professionals can non-invasively identify and pinpoint termite activity, laying the groundwork for the advancement of customized treatment strategies, such as those offered by termite control services in Canberra.
As soon as an active problem is confirmed, the pest controller usually suggests one of two main techniques, or a mix thereof: chemical soil barriers or external baiting systems.
Chemical barriers are thought about a highly reliable method of preventing termites and are an essential element of Termite Treatments in Canberra. This method entails establishing a treated barrier in the soil encircling the entire border of the structure. Advanced liquid termiticides are developed to be undetectable by termites, permitting them to unintentionally travel through the dealt with soil. As they do so, they become infected and consequently transfer the slow-acting poison back to the main colony through activities like grooming and sharing food (referred to as trophallaxis). This leads to the steady eradication of the entire colony, including the queen. The sturdiness of these barriers-- normally backed by service warranties lasting five to 10 years-- relies on factors such as the particular item utilized, soil qualities (with heavy clay keeping the chemical longer than sandy soil), and the accuracy of installation treatments, which frequently involve trenching and injecting the termiticide below concrete pieces and paving.
An alternative method that is well-suited for properties where utilizing a chemical barrier is not practical or for actively getting rid of termite nests is through baiting systems. These systems involve putting monitoring stations strategically in the ground around the residential or commercial property's boundary. When termite activity is detected in a station, a poisonous bait, normally a cellulose matrix including an insect development regulator, is presented. This bait is attracting the employee termites, who consume it and carry it back to the nest. The slow-acting nature of the bait is essential, enabling thorough circulation throughout the nest, ultimately leading to the queen's failure and the whole population's demise. The advantage of baiting systems in Termite Treatments Canberra is their direct targeting and removal of the colony, instead of merely driving away or developing a shield around the residential or commercial property. However, these systems necessitate regular expert monitoring every couple of months to ensure the bait is renewed and the system remains efficient.
To successfully select a termite treatment in Canberra, it's important to employ a certified specialist who can examine the building's design, environmental factors, termite type, and extent of damage. New buildings frequently integrate physical termite barriers, such as metal mesh or specialized membranes, with chemical treatments to meet building codes. On the other hand, dealing with an existing older home might include using a chemical barrier for ongoing defense, supplemented by baiting to eliminate any current termite activity. The Environmental Protection Authority in the ACT oversees pest control practices, ensuring that just qualified specialists utilizing authorized chemicals can perform termite treatments.
